Output 6f305528ddbefdacfd959bd44bdb377eeb1e4a2da14a9faf1207e9695a4be54a:77

value
4653402
script pubkey
OP_0 OP_PUSHBYTES_20 853deb671dbebf8d13de500db72d82441afe725f
address
bc1qs577kecah6lc6y772qxmwtvzgsd0uujljjnvcm
transaction
6f305528ddbefdacfd959bd44bdb377eeb1e4a2da14a9faf1207e9695a4be54a
confirmations
271347
spent
true